Sources

  1. First-hand information as remembered by Steven Staley, Saturday, April 19, 2014. Replace this citation if there is another source.
  • Brown, Alexander (1895). The Cabells and their Kin, p. 228. Says she was of "The Brooke", in Henrico County, and incorrectly calls her the 1st wife. Evidently living in 1803 when her daughter died at Chellow.
  • "The Ancestors and Descendants of John Rolfe", in The Virginia Magazine of History and Biography, Vol. 22, no. 3 (Jul 1914), p. 332.
  • Robertson, Wyndham (1887), Pocahontas and her Descendants, p. 32, p. 35 (children).
